Jaipur. Once again the weather in Rajasthan is in a mood to take a turn. According to the Meteorological Department, due to the effect of a new Western Disturbance, there is a possibility of light rain with moderate thunderstorm activities in Sriganganagar and Hanumangarh districts including Jodhpur division of western Rajasthan on March 13 afternoon. On the other hand, in Udaipur, Ajmer, Kota and Jaipur divisions of eastern Rajasthan during March 13-14, there are possibilities of sudden strong winds at one or two places along with thunderstorms in the afternoon at some places.
According to the Meteorological Department, there is a strong possibility of another new Western Disturbance becoming active in Rajasthan on March 16 and 17. Due to its effect, there is a possibility of increase in thunderstorm activities in the state. At present, the maximum temperature in most parts of Rajasthan is being recorded 2 to 6 degree Celsius above the average. In the last 24 hours till 8 am on Sunday, the highest maximum temperature has been recorded in Barmer at 37.2 degrees (+2.7 degrees above average) and in Phalodi at 37.2 degrees (+3.9 degrees above average).
Farmers ruined in many areas due to unseasonal rain and hailstorm
For the last few days, there is an atmosphere of uncertainty in the weather in Rajasthan. In the past, there has been hailstorm along with rain at many places in Rajasthan. Crops have been badly damaged due to hailstorm. Farmers have been ruined in many areas due to unseasonal rains and hailstorms. In some areas, the entire crops of the farmers have been destroyed. The government has issued orders for special girdawari in hailstorm affected areas.

Jalore and Barmer districts of Jodhpur division suffered maximum damage.
The maximum damage due to unseasonal rains and hailstorm has happened in Jalore and Barmer districts of Jodhpur division of western Rajasthan. There the crops got buried under the hail and spread on the ground. At the same time, due to strong winds in many places, crops have suffered heavy damage. Due to the destruction of crops due to natural calamity, the back of the farmers has been broken. Meanwhile, heavy hail fell in Sirohi’s Mount Abu.
